Ten of the world’s 23 most “notorious” pirate websites are based in EU countries, while another five are in Russia or Ukraine, the US government says.

The US trade chief said piracy harms America's creative industries (Photo: J Sonder)


The report, published on Wednesday (12 February), by The Office of the United States Trade Department Representative, lists websites which “undermine critical US comparative advantages in innovation and creativity to the detriment of American workers” due to their “global … scale and popularity.”

The EU list includes: baixedetudo.net (Sweden); darkwarez.pl (Poland); mp3skull.com (UK); putlocker.com (UK); rapidshare.com (Czech Republic); seriesyonkis.com (Spain); thepiratebay.se (Sweden); uploaded.net (Netherlands); wawa-mania.ec (France); and zamunda.net (Bulgaria).

Another one, torrentz.eu, is said to be hosted in Canada or Finland, while rapidgator.net, is said to have moved from the UK to Russia. Russia is also reported as the home of rutracker.org and vkontakte.com. Ukraine is named for ex.ua and extratorrent.cc

The rest are either in Antigua and Barbuda, Canada, China, or Vietnam.
